85 Andrew Buenrostro
85 - Andrew Buenrostro
Height: 6-4
Weight: 235
Year: Frosh
High School: La Serna
Position: TE
Major: Undecided

Cerritos Football (2011): Served as a red-shirt… Came to Cerritos as a quarterback, but is being moved to tight end…..

La Serna HS: Named his school’s Male Athlete of the Year as a senior, while also earning the Del Rio League’s Most Valuable Player after leading the league in passing with over 2,000 yards and 16 touchdowns… Was a four-year Scholar-Athlete… Completed 58% of his passes and rushed for over 200 yards… Also earned 1st Team All-CIF and 1st Team all-league, while he received his team’s Offensive MVP Award and earned the Earnie Cooper Memorial Scholarship Award… Team won the league championship his senior year and reached the Southeast Division semi-finals… Was the starting quarterback in the 605 All-Star Game… As a junior, he led the league in passing, while being voted the league’s MVP and 1st Team all-league… Passed for over 1,500 yards… Spent four years on the football team and was also on the basketball team for one season… As a senior, he was a 1st Team all-league pick and All-Area honorable mention selection, while serving as their captain and helped them win the league championship… Selected to play in the Sargents All-Star Game…..

Personal: Most memorable moment was when he completed 10-of-13 passes for four touchdowns and rushed for another touchdown against California High, as well as when the team defeated Whittier High on the last play of the game… Would like to transfer to UCLA or any other school that offers him a scholarship… Aspires to be a high school teacher and coach… Likes to play the guitar in his spare time… Nicknamed “Bueno”… Has four siblings – Jack (30), Vanessa (28), Daniel (26) and Rebecca (25)… Is the son of Alfred and Patty Buenrostro… Born in Whittier, CA on December 22, 1992…..
